‘Tis the Season For Hair Tips

It’s the season for events galore and regular visits to the hairdresser; little surprise really that conversation at a recent Girls’ Night Out inside the Regency Bar & Lounge led from one subject to the next, and then there was hair talk – getting your hair event-ready.

(Photos: Lionel Rookwood)

Tahnida Nunes: Senior Sponsorship Marketing Manager, Digicel

Hairstylist: Ruth Bryan 10 Windsor Avenue, Kingston 6

Holiday Hair Tips: Biotin, Omega 3, and drink lots of water.

Jacqueline Burrell-Clarke: Public Relations Manager, Digicel

Hairstylist: Ruth Bryan 10 Windsor Avenue, Kingston 6

Holiday Hair Tips: Keep hair moist; ensure a proper diet with lots of greens; and lots of Biotin hair vitamin.

Semone Thaxter, Human Resource and Communications Director at Celebrations Brands Limited

Hairstylist: Sophia, at Sophia Lee Que Salon, 14 Gloucester Ave, Kingston 6

Holiday Hair Tips: Regular conditioning; keep hair clean and trim often to keep hair bouncy; wrap hair at nights with a silk scarf.

Tshani JaJa: Marketing Manager at Jamaica Yellow Pages

Stylist: Tshani Jaja

Holiday Hair Tips: Moisturise natural hair regularly. Twist hair at nights and wrap with a silk scarf.

Ayisha Richards-McKay: Crown counsel, Commercial Affairs and Litigation Divisions- Attorney General’s Chambers

Hairstylist: Paulette Brown at 4 Springvale Avenue Kingston 10

Holiday Hair Tips: Keep hair clean and moisturise regularly.

Toni Spence: Business Strategy Manager at GraceKennedy Money Services

Hairstylist: Suzanne Wilson, 9 Merrick Avenue Kingston 10

Holiday Hair Tips: Use All natural, OXX System LTD products and shampoo every five days.

Kaysia Johnson-Vaughan: Marketing manager programmes, Scotiabank Jamaica Limited

Hairstylist: Lykah at Passion Exquisite Style Shop # 12 Park Plaza Kingston 10

Holiday Hair Tips: Regular hair treatments and wrap tresses at night.

Avadaugn Sinclair: Marketing Manager at Best Dressed Chicken

Hairstylist: Andrea Williams 10 Merrivale Avenue Kingston 10

Holiday Hair Tips: Keep short hair in tip-top condition by trimming ends often.

Naomi Garrick: Managing Director, Garrick Communications

Hairstylist: Neahlis, Lisa McIntosh-Aris, 19 Ardenne Road, Kingston 10

Holiday Hair Tips: Moisturise daily with Optimum Oil Therapy products.

Rochelle Cameron: Head of Legal and Regulatory and Company Secretary for Lime

Hairstylist: Lisa Hutchinson from Lisa’s 11/2 Altamont Crescent Kingston 5

Holiday Hair Tip: Go to Lisa Hutchinson for a good cut.

Joan Webley: Founder and attorney-at-law for Nanook Enterprises

Stylist: Joan Webley

Holiday Hair Tips: Moisturise frequently, have fun with your hair and experiment.

Ayesha Creary: Creative Marketing strategist

Hairstylist: Nerissa Stewart at Rejuvenation in Liguanea

Holiday Hair Tips: I have light-bodied hair and an issue with dryness. I believe in castor oil for strengthening and the use of mousse and root- thickening hairspray. I don’t shampoo often but try to condition frequently to add moisture.

Bianca Bartley: Jewellery designer, Peace-is of Bianca.

Hairstylist: Lisa Hutchinson of Lisa’s hair salon 11/2 Altamont Crescent

Holiday Hair Tip: Keep hair clean.

Odette Dixon-Neath: Public Relations Director, CGR Communications

Hairstylist: Lisa Hutchinson at Lisa’s

Holiday Hair Tips: Keep your hair looking fab with regular trims and Jane Carter Nourishing Serum.
